Winning always takes teamwork, but on Tuesday Mackenzie Orton stepped things up a notch to give Union County the 'W'. Orton scored two runs while going 3-for-5. The effort marked the most hits she has had since back in March of 2024.
Orton and Union County will get to enjoy the win for a while: their next game is against P.K. Yonge at 7:00 p.m. on April 1st. Union County has been dominating on the road and they will enter the game having won three straight away games. Will Orton and the rest of the Fightin' Tigers crew be able to keep the streak alive?
